Mar 31, 2014 fog computing is a paradigm that extends cloud computing and services to the edge of the network. Similar to cloud, fog provides data, compute, storage, and application services to endusers. Fog computing is the new buzz word added to the technical world. Fog computing is a layer of computation, storage, and networking that can reside between iot sensors and the cloud to allow for faster response times and improved security, explains charles byers, tec. Nov, 2015 in this paper, we have discussed current definitions of fog computing and similar concepts, and proposed a more comprehensive definition. We finally implemented and evaluated a prototype fog computing platform. Fog computing and its ecosystem presentation title. The term fog computing was introduced by the cisco systems. The fog extends the cloud to be closer to the things that produce and act on iot data figure 2. Cloud computing is the process of using remote servers or computers across the internet to perform data operations, storage and managing data instead of using a local computer or server. Superuser reader user6322 wants to know what fog computing is. Cloud computing vs fog computing top 7 amazing differences. It provides data, compute, storage and application services to the users like cloud. Oct 14, 2016 fog computing or edge computing is a new mega trend in the big data and iot world this article explores what it is and what it means.
Finally, we describe fog computing architecture, how the intermediate fog layers in the network enable a very rich application ecosystem and how they create opportunities for new network. Fog computing is a layer of computation, storage, and networking that can reside between iot sensors and the cloud to allow for faster response times and improved security, explains charles byers, tec 10272014. Cloud computing, fog computing enables a new breed of applications and services, and that there is a fruitful interplay between the cloud and the fog, particularly when it comes to data management and analytics. An overview of fog computing and its security issues. Fog computing or edge computing is a new mega trend in the big data and iot world this article explores what it is and what it means. The term fog computing was introduced by the cisco systems as new model to ease wireless data transfer to distributed devices in the internet of things iot network paradigm.
Fog computing, also known as foggingedge computing, it is a model in which data, processing and applications are concentrated in devices at the network edge rather than existing almost entirely in the cloud. Processing data closer to where it is produced and needed solves the challenges of exploding data volume, variety, and velocity. Fog computing extends cloud computing by providing virtualized resources and engaged locationbased services to the edge of the mobile networks so as to better serve mobile traffics. The distinguishing fog characteristics are its proximity to endusers, its dense geographical distribution, and its support for mobility. Despite the broad utilization of cloud computing, some applications and services still cannot benefit from this popular computing paradigm due to inherent problems of cloud computing such as unacceptable latency, lack of mobility support and locationawareness. Industrial automation is a key goal for iot developers, and at hannover messe, the worlds largest industrial trade show, connectivity software provider clabs on april announced the availability of new fog and cloudbased products to simplify the creation of industrial automation iot solutions. Feb 06, 2015 the fog computing is a promising solution towards this goal. It is a promising complementary computing paradigm to cloud.
Rapid increase in number and diversity of internetconnected devices raises many challenges for the traditional network architecture, which is not designed to support a high level of scalability, realtime data delivery and mobility. Fog provides data, compute, storage, and application services to endusers. Dec 18, 2019 fog computing has a number of advantages. Fog computing is a scenario where a huge number of heterogeneous wireless and sometimes autonomous. The effects of fog computing on cloud computing and big data systems may vary. Abstract cloud services to smart things face latency and intermittent connectivity issues. This overview is compiled and structured, based on several public documents belonging to different authors and groups, on cloudfog, mobile edge computing, 4g5g networking, sdn, nfv, etc. Localgrid fog computing platform datasheet the localgrid fog computing platform fog computing is an emerging discipline within the computer networking industry that describes the connection of sensors, devices, and machines the edge to the internet the cloud and to each other. This work, one of the first attempts in its domain. Cloud computing is the process of running ict tasks and services and storing computer resources over the internet.
Pdf a study on cloud and fog computing security issues. The iot nodes are with various sensors and generate local data. Pdf a study on cloud and fog computing security issues and. Mar 11, 2015 finally, we describe fog computing architecture, how the intermediate fog layers in the network enable a very rich application ecosystem and how they create opportunities for new network. Similar to cloud computing but with distinct characteristics, fog computing faces new security and privacy challenges besides those inherited from cloud computing. Differences between cloud computing vs fog computing. The motivation of fog computing lies in a series of real scenarios, such as smart grid, smart traffic lights in vehicular networks and software. To address these issues, in this paper we present a new model of internet of things architecture which combines benefits of two emerging technologies.
It would be very difficult to define fog computing without first defining cloud computing, since fog computing is basically an extension of the cloud. Fog computing or fog networking, also known as fogging, is an architecture that uses edge devices to carry out a substantial amount of computation, storage, and communication locally and routed over the internet backbone. Overview of cloudlet, fog computing, edge computing, and dew. The fog nodes are devices with more computing power than usual iot nodes. Fog computing and its ecosystem presentation title goes here. In this way, it is possible to distribute resources and services of computing, storage, and networking along the cloudtothings continuum. By adding the capability to process data closer to where it is created, fog computing seeks to create a network with lower latency, and with less data to. This results in a lack of quality of the obtained content. Mobile edge computing versus fog computing in internet of. Fog computing is a technology that extends cloud computing and services to the edge of the network. These devices can be situated anywhere with a network connection which can be factory, a.
Theyre part of the cisco iot system, a comprehensive set of products for deploying, accelerating value, and innovating with the internet of things. Fog computing is a promising computing paradigm that extends cloud computing to the edge of networks. Cloud computing offers delivery services directly over the internet. Fog computing paradigm extends the storage, networking, and computing facilities of the cloud computing toward the edge of the networks while offloading th. The term fog computing or edge computing means that rather than hosting and working from a centralized cloud, fog systems operate on network ends.
Mar, 2018 in this pdf seminar report, we discuss the basic introduction of fog computing, its architecture, its role in iot, and working principle of fog network. Fog computing can be perceived both in large cloud systems and big data structures, making reference to the growing difficulties in accessing information objectively. The fog extends the cloud to be closer to the devices that produce and act on iot data. Fog computing, mobile edge computing, cloudlets which one. Cisco fog computing solutions include everything you need to. These devices, called fog nodes, can be deployed anywhere with a network connection. Existing research works on fog computing have primarily focused on the principles and concepts of fog computing and its significance in the context of internet of things iot. Oct 24, 2016 rapid increase in number and diversity of internetconnected devices raises many challenges for the traditional network architecture, which is not designed to support a high level of scalability, realtime data delivery and mobility. Fog computing is a recent research eld that has substantial overlap with edgecentric computing. Proponents of fog computing argue that it can reduce the need for bandwidth by not sending every bit of information over cloud channels.
Introduction fog computing is a service started by networking giant, cisco. Pdf fog computing and its real time applications poonam. This overview is compiled and structured, based on several public documents belonging to different authors and groups, on cloudfog, mobile edge computing, 4g5g networking, sdn. Pdf in recent years, the number of internet of things iot devicessensors has increased to a great extent. Fog computing is a term for an alternative to cloud computing that puts some kinds of transactions and resources at the edge of a network, rather than establishing channels for cloud storage and utilization. It is a term for placing some processes and resources at the edge of the cloud, instead of establishing channels for cloud storage and utilization. Open journal of cloud computing ojcc, volume 2, issue 1, 2015 figure 1. Also, we observe the difference between cloud computing, fog computing, and edge computing. Fog computing is a paradigm for managing a highly distributed and possibly virtualized environment that provides compute and network services between sensors and cloud data centers. Conceptually, fog computing consists of 3 main components, a iot nodes, b fog nodes, and c backend cloud. By adding the capability to process data closer to where it is created, fog computing seeks to create a.
The fog computing environment consists of devices that are close to the network edge, between end users and traditional cloud servers tier 2 10 and possess processing, storage and communication power. As a result, fog computing, has emerged as a promising infrastructure to provide elastic resources at the edge of. The decade phases of the development of ict and its relations to the gphenomena and distributed computing hierarchy. Cisco defines fog computing as a paradigm that extends cloud computing and services to the edge of the network.
The industrial internet consortium iic will enable and accelerate adoption of the industrial internet which is essential to growth and competitiveness in key industry sectors, including. On security and privacy issues of fog computing supported. Fog computing fc can be a suitable paradigm to overcome these limitations, as it can coexist and cooperate with centralized cloud systems and extends the latter toward the network edge. We also analyzed the goals and challenges in fog computing platform, and presented platform design with several exemplar applications. Overview of cloudlet, fog computing, edge computing, and.
Fog computing essentially extends cloud computing and services. In this pdf seminar report, we discuss the basic introduction of fog computing, its architecture, its role in iot, and working principle of fog network. Xx, august 2015 1 energy managementasaservice over fog computing platform mohammad abdullah al faruque, member, ieee, korosh vatanparvar, student member, ieee. As an example, we study a typical attack, maninthemiddle attack, for the discussion of security in fog computing. The fog computing is a promising solution towards this goal. Security and privacy issues are further disclosed according to current fog computing paradigm. Fog computing is an emerging technology to address computing and networking bottlenecks in large scale deployment of iot applications. Home conferences mobisys proceedings mobidata 15 a survey of fog computing. The pdf and ppt reports are based on research papers of fog computing. From kitchen equipment to aeroplane, started getting an ip address. Cloud computing is the significant part of the data world. Fog computing can address those problems by providing elastic resources and services to end users at the edge of network, while cloud computing are more about providing resources distributed in the core network.
A cloud to the ground support for smart things and machinetomachine networks. Xx, august 2015 1 energy managementasaservice over fog computing platform mohammad abdullah al faruque, member, ieee, korosh vatanparvar, student member, ieee abstractby introduction of microgrids, energy management is required to control the power generation and consumption. Fog computing is a paradigm that extends cloud computing and services to the edge of the network. Therefore, fog computing is a lubricant of the combination of cloud computing and mobile applications. Fog computing gives the cloud a companion to handle the two exabytes of data generated daily from the internet of things. Thus fog computing is a collaboration of internet of things and cloud computing. Fog computing, also known as fog networking or fogging, is a decentralized computing infrastructure in which data, compute, storage and applications are distributed in the most logical, efficient place between the data source and the cloud. Fog computing and its role in the internet of things. Cisco fog computing solutions meet all of these requirements. A survey of fog computing proceedings of the 2015 workshop. I am reading a work on cloud services and it touches briefly on fog computing as an example of a possible future development branch of softwarehardware infrastructure, but does not specify what it is exactly or any of its benefits. Fog computing is generally considered as a nontrivial extension of cloud computing from the core network to the edge network 2. Fog computing tackles an important problem in cloud computing, namely, reducing the. Fog computing can address those problems by providing elastic resources.
570 333 97 442 921 1075 1237 144 1334 1195 1559 840 1262 263 1047 68 1289 966 199 63 542 1295 952 420 1651 1385 886 495 1376 403 259 320 107 1192 133